The defining feature here is the angled or bulbous tip — it's not about length, it's about leverage. When you insert a curved vibrator and angle it upward, the head rests against the G-spot (that spongy tissue about two inches in, toward your belly button). You control the pressure by tilting the handle, so you're not straining your wrist or guessing at the angle. Shorter shafts with pronounced curves often work better than long, gently-curved models — think leverage, not depth.

Most G-spot vibrators pair internal rumble with a handle designed for grip during use. You'll see rounded bulbs (for broad pressure), tapered tips (for pinpoint targeting), and dual-motor designs that add clitoral stimulation without requiring a second toy. If you've tried a straight vibrator and felt like you were chasing sensation, a dedicated gspot vibrator removes the guesswork — the curve does the anatomical work for you.

One common hesitation: "What if I can't find my G-spot?" The curve itself is your guide. Insert the toy with the curve facing up, then rock the handle gently toward your belly button. You'll feel the tip press into the front wall. Start with steady pressure before turning on vibration — many people find the come-hither motion (rocking the toy rather than thrusting) more effective than in-and-out movement.

How to Choose a G-Spot Vibrator

  • Curve sharpness: A pronounced angle (think dolphin-nose shape) delivers more concentrated pressure than a gradual arc. If you're new, start with a moderate curve — you can always move to a more aggressive angle once you know what feels right.
  • Tip shape: Bulbous heads spread sensation across a wider area; tapered tips focus intensity on a smaller zone. Broader tips work well if you're still mapping where your G-spot responds; pointed tips suit experienced users chasing precision.
  • Length and girth: Most effective G-spot vibes are 4-6 inches insertable. You're targeting a spot close to the entrance, not the cervix. Girth matters more for fullness — slimmer designs let you focus on angle without stretching.
  • Motor placement: Internal-only motors keep all the power at the tip. Dual-motor models add a clitoral arm or external pad, letting you layer sensations without juggling two toys. Choose dual-motor if you know you need blended stimulation to finish.
  • Handle design: A flared base or looped handle gives you leverage for angling and rocking. Smooth, rounded bodies without a distinct handle require more wrist control — manageable for short sessions, tiring for extended play.
  • Power source: Rechargeable models (USB or magnetic charging) deliver stronger, more consistent vibration than battery-powered options. If you want deep rumble rather than surface buzz, skip the AAA batteries.

What Pairs Well with G-Spot Vibrators

Most users pair a G-spot vibe with water-based lube — the curve needs smooth glide to reach the right angle without friction. A sex toy cleaner keeps body-safe silicone hygienic between uses (soap and water work, but dedicated cleaners are faster and pH-balanced). If you're exploring anal play alongside G-spot stimulation, a butt plug adds internal fullness that intensifies both sensations. For hands-free options, some users combine a G-spot vibrator with a suction vibrator on the clitoris, layering external and internal pleasure without coordination.

What's the difference between a G-spot vibe and a regular internal vibrator? G-spot vibrators have a pronounced curve or angled tip that targets the anterior vaginal wall, while straight vibrators rely on depth and length. The curve provides leverage — you tilt the handle to apply pressure exactly where the G-spot responds, without straining your wrist or guessing at the angle.

Should I choose a G-spot vibrator with clitoral stimulation built in? It depends on whether you typically need blended stimulation to orgasm. Dual-motor designs (sometimes called rabbit vibes when they include a clitoral arm) let you layer internal and external pleasure without coordinating two separate toys. If you're unsure, start with an internal-only G-spot vibe — you can always add a bullet vibrator or suction toy externally once you know what combination works.

How do I clean a G-spot vibrator after use? Wash the insertable portion with warm water and mild soap or a dedicated sex toy cleaner, paying attention to any textured ridges near the tip. If the toy is fully waterproof (check the product details), you can submerge it. Pat dry and store in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.
